Types of Personal Data Collected and Processed

The categories of personal data that can be collected through the Service can be used to identify natural persons from names, emails, pictures, and videos; information from Facebook and LinkedIn accounts; answers to questions asked through the recruiting, titles, education; and other information that the User or others have provided through the Service. Only data that is relevant to the recruitment process is collected and processed.

 

 

Purpose and Lawfulness of Processing

The purpose of collecting and processing personal data is to manage recruiting. The lawfulness of the processing of personal data is based on legal obligation and legitimate interest to simplify and facilitate recruitment.

3.Users’ Rights

Users have the right to request information about the personal data that is processed by the controller, by notifying in writing via the contact details below or on Controller’s website. Users have the right to one (1) copy of the processed personal data that belongs to them without any charge. For further demanded copies, the Controller has the right to charge a reasonable fee on the basis of the administrative costs for such demand.

Users have the right to, if necessary, rectification of inaccurate personal data concerning that User, via a written request, using the contact details herein or on Controller’s website.

The User has the right to demand deletion or restriction of processing and the right to object to processing based on legitimate interest under certain circumstances.

The User has the right to revoke any consent to processing that has been given by the User to the Controller. Using this right may, however, mean that the User cannot apply for a specific job or otherwise use the Service.

The User has under certain circumstances a right to data portability, which means a right to get the personal data and transfer these to another controller as long as this does not negatively affect the rights and freedoms of others.

The User has the right to lodge a complaint to the supervisory authority regarding the processing of personal data relating to him or her if the User considers that the processing of personal data infringes the legal framework of privacy law.

7.Cookies

When Users use the Service, information about the usage may be stored as cookies. Cookies are passive text files that are stored in the internet browser on the User’s device, such as a computer, mobile phone, or tablet, when using the Service. The use of cookies aims to improve the User’s usage of the Service and to gather information about, for example, statistics about the usage of the Service. This is done to secure, maintain, and improve the Service. The information that is collected through the cookies can, in some instances, be personal data and is, in such instances, regulated by the Service Cookie Policy.

Users can at any time disable the use of cookies by changing the local settings on their devices. Disabling cookies can affect the experience of the Service, for example, disabling some functions in the Service.
